Miguel Díaz: “Spanish tennis was not very happy with the new Davis Cup”

Ethe president of the Real Federacin Espaola de Tenis, Miguel Daz Romn, has declared that the body he presides overor are you “very happy” with the new format of the Davis Cup, so he hopes that it will return to a competition with a different system “since this format It hasn’t been the best.”

Miguel Diaz, who is in Ceuta On the occasion of the celebration in the city of the Interterritorial Commission of the RFET, which is attended by the 19 presidents of territorial federations, he also referred to the company Kosmos Tennis, chaired by ex-soccer player Gerard Piqu and that it organized the Davis Cup with the new format. “Kosmos has tried to change the format and it has not given the results that were thought. Hopefully it will return to something intermediate, because for our part we were not very happy in the last year of the experience either.”

“Of the three years with the new format we won the first edition, it has been held in Spain these three years but, despite that, as the Spanish Federation we see that when teams from other countries come there is not that hobby that can drag as it happens in football, so it has not given the results we thought”.

In his opinion, the Davis Cup “must change and you can go back to the old format in three days in five venueswhich would be a good thing, as long as the best players were achieved through financial incentives or ATP points.

He bet on recovering the previous system “because the fans really took that vacation weekends, bullrings were filled with 15,000 people and created a lot of fans. What was now is not the best for tennis in general,” he insisted.

Regarding the possibility of ending this matter in court, he commented that both Kosmos and the ITF denounce mutually because both one and the other will say that they have breached what was agreed” and reiterated that “if we know how to do it from now on, the format, if it is changed, could give good results”.
